SFP+ Ports

PowerConnect M8024-k provides four SFP+ ports with SR, LR, and LRM
transceivers and SFP+ direct attach cables. SFP transceivers and direct
attach cables are sold separately.

Expansion Slot

The 10G expansion slot supports the following modules:
SFP+ (four ports)
CX-4 (three ports)
10GBASE-T (two ports)
The modules are sold separately.

USB Console Port

The USB console port is for management through an RS-232serial interface.
This port provides a direct connection to the switch and allows you to access
the CLI from a console terminal connected to the port through the provided
serial cable (with USB type-A to female DB-9 connectors).
The console port supports asynchronous data of eight data bits, one stop bit, no
parity bit, and no flow control. The default baud rate is 9600 bps.

Port and System LEDs

The front panel contains light emitting diodes (LEDs) that provide
information about the status of the PowerConnect M8024-k unit.
